FacePOS Ltd. is an Irish fintech founded in 2023, headquartered in Sligo Ireland, developing an instant, account-to-account payment platform that enables secure, irrevocable payments at physical and digital points of sale using Open Banking and SEPA Instant rails.

Key issues or challenges experienced during the start-up process

The primary challenges were navigating regulatory complexity, gaining early credibility with banks and regulatory bodies, and building a payments solution that met both technical and supervisory expectations.

How you addressed these challenges

We engaged early with regulators. Consultants and Fintech Ireland, aligned our product architecture with EU payments frameworks, and focused heavily on compliance-by-design and strong governance.

Key supports received during the start-up phase

Strategic mentoring, market validation support, and access to experienced advisors were critical during our early stages.

The role WestBIC played during your start-up

WestBIC provided invaluable support through guidance, challenge, and validation, helping us refine our business model, investor narrative, and regulatory positioning.

Words of advice for new start-ups

Engage early with Local Enterprise Offices, WestBIC, customers and if needed regulators, build compliance into your product from day one, and focus on solving a real problem at scale.

Where the company is now

FacePOS is actively engaging with banks, regulators, and enterprise partners across Europe, advancing pilot projects, expanding its product roadmap, and preparing for a wider market rollout. The company was one of nine successful applicants (out of 38) to join the Central Bank of Ireland Innovation in Payments Sandbox programme.


Positioned as a foundational infrastructure layer for instant payments at the point of sale, FacePOS is aligning its solutions with upcoming EU Instant Payments Regulation milestones to enable seamless, real-time transactions.
